Mother Earth - Father Sky
~*Marge Tindal*~

Shyly, she peeks up from her bed
seeking the dew of the morn
knowing that he is bathing her
in the sunshine of his adorn

From on high he watches
as she dresses for the morning
sending the light from his eyes
to the glow of her adorning

On her shouldering mountains
a meadowlark in song
filling the valley below
with a morning sing-a-long

He sends to her soft breezes
to carry songs across the land
watches as the rivers flow
with just the touch of her hand

She looks to the skies in awe
knowing he is there
sending down the gentle rains
filling the crevices that she wears

He sometimes covers her playground
with deepening shadows of gray
serving as a respite
shading the heat of day

She pirouettes in colors
proudly across the land
knowing that he sends
the seasons gently from his hand

When day is done he sends
the moon to set her aglow
with stars aplenty
crossing the sky just so

She smiles in easy shadows
glistening with the beams
knowing he set the stars
to twinkle in her dreams

Mother Earth - Father Sky
gloriously wed
Tread her trails lightly
then lift your head

You will have envisioned
the greatest dance of time
Mother Earth - Father Sky
caught in the rhythm of rhyme

God has made the marriage
to last until time slips away
Mother Earth for a lifetime
Father Sky for always
